package com.linecorp.armeria.common.http;
import static net.javacrumbs.jsonunit.fluent.JsonFluentAssert.assertThatJson;
import org.junit.Test;
import com.fasterxml.jackson.databind.ObjectMapper;
import io.netty.util.AsciiString;
public class HttpHeadersJsonSerializerTest {
private static final AsciiString NAME = AsciiString.of("a");
private static final ObjectMapper mapper = new ObjectMapper();
@Test
public void singleValue() {
assertThatJson(mapper.valueToTree(HttpHeaders.of(NAME, "0"))).isEqualTo("{\"a\":\"0\"}");
}
@Test
public void multipleValues() {
final HttpHeaders headers = new DefaultHttpHeaders();
headers.add(NAME, "0");
headers.add(NAME, "1");
assertThatJson(mapper.valueToTree(headers)).isEqualTo("{\"a\":[\"0\",\"1\"]}");
}
}
